LAND EXTENSION: Green Valleys and Golden Sands | | Bienvenido a Costa Rica! | Bienvenido a Costa Rica! Come experience nature at its sexiest, endowed with tropical rainforests, red-hot volcanoes and lush, luscious flora, Costa Rica seduces even the most fanatic of urbanites. Although Costa Rica is a small country, a large variety of tropical habitats are found here and the best-developed conservation program in Latin America protects them.
This Seabourn Land Program will take you to the Rainforest Aerial Tram, where one will glide silently through the green vegetation, to a famous coffee estate, on a nature hike to explore the large variety of flora and fauna. There will be many opportunities to enjoy the friendly hospitality and to try local specialties.
Costa Rica is a legacy of Peace and Culture that gives this small country a unique character and identity. Among the first countries in the world to sport public lighting, one of the leading democracies in the world standing alone without an army, Costa Rica is more than just scenic valleys and beautiful beaches, it is a recipe for the body, the spirit and the soul. | |
